Contact Us
Transforming Business with Custom Software Development: Your Complete Guide - bamboodt.com

Transforming Business with Custom Software Development: Your Complete Guide

In the rapidly evolving landscape of technology, businesses must remain agile and responsive to market demands. One of the pivotal strategies for achieving this adaptability is through custom software development. As businesses scale and diversify their operations, off-the-shelf software solutions often fall short, becoming bottlenecks rather than catalysts for growth. This article explores the transformative power of custom software development, detailing how it can revolutionize efficiency, enhance productivity, and align perfectly with a company’s unique processes.

The Need for Custom Software Development

Every business is distinct. The processes, challenges, and goals vary significantly from one organization to another. While generic software products may address common needs, they often lack the flexibility and functionality that a business requires to innovate and lead in its industry. Custom software development looks to bridge this gap by providing tailored solutions that address specific business challenges.

Understanding Custom Software

Custom software is developed specifically for a particular organization, designed to meet its unique requirements and specifications. This bespoke software is often built from the ground up or extensively modified to ensure it serves the desired functions effectively. Examples of custom software solutions include:

  • Enterprise Resource Planning (ERP) systems tailored to a company’s processes
  • Customer Relationship Management (CRM) systems with unique features for user engagement
  • Mobile applications designed specifically for the company’s services or products
  • Inventory management software optimized for specific product lines

Benefits of Custom Software Development

Investing in custom software development can yield substantial returns for a business. Here are some key benefits:

1. Enhanced Efficiency and Productivity

With tools designed precisely for the tasks at hand, employees can complete their work more effectively and efficiently. Custom software eliminates unnecessary features, minimizes complications, and streamlines processes, allowing employees to focus more on their core responsibilities rather than navigating complexities.

2. Competitive Advantage

Having unique software that addresses specific operational challenges can give organizations a significant edge over their competition. Custom solutions allow for faster implementation of innovative features, leading to quicker adaptability in the fast-paced market environment.

3. Scalability

Custom software is built with your business’s future in mind. As you grow, your software can evolve in tandem, adding new features or adjusting existing ones to accommodate increasing complexity. This scalability ensures that technology supports development rather than hindering it.

4. Integration with Existing Systems

Many businesses already utilize various software systems. Custom development allows for integration with existing tools to create a cohesive technology ecosystem. This interoperability can enhance the flow of information and support reporting and analytics initiatives more effectively.

5. Enhanced Security

With cyber threats becoming increasingly sophisticated, security is paramount. Custom software development enables businesses to implement tailored security measures that generic software solutions may not provide, ensuring sensitive data remains protected.

Factors to Consider in Custom Software Development

While the benefits are compelling, it’s essential to approach custom software development thoughtfully. Here are critical considerations:

1. Clear Objectives

Before embarking on the development process, organizations must clearly define their needs and objectives. Having a well-defined scope ensures the developed software is aligned with business goals and user requirements, minimizing challenges during and post-development.

2. Choosing the Right Development Partner

The success of a custom software project largely hinges on the development partner chosen. Look for companies with a proven track record, technical expertise, and understanding of your business sector. Transparency and communication are also crucial to ensure alignment throughout the project lifecycle.

3. Agile Development Methodology

Utilizing agile methodologies fosters a collaborative environment where feedback is incorporated iteratively. This can lead to a more refined end product as developers continually adjust based on user insights and changing business requirements.

Case Studies: Success Stories

To illustrate the tangible benefits of custom software, let’s explore two case studies of organizations that capitalized on bespoke solutions:

Case Study 1: A Retail Giant Streamlines Operations

A prominent retail company faced challenges with inventory management and customer relationship tracking. By investing in custom software development, they obtained a streamlined inventory management system that integrated directly with their sales platforms. This resulted in a 40% reduction in stock discrepancies and significantly improved customer satisfaction, with feedback demonstrated through increased sales and lower return rates.

Case Study 2: Enhancing Engagement in the Healthcare Sector

An organization in the healthcare sector aimed to improve patient engagement through tailored software solutions. The custom platform enabled real-time communication between patients and healthcare providers, appointment scheduling, and access to personal health records. The initiative led to a measurable increase in patient satisfaction scores, showing the importance of investing in tailored technological solutions.

Step-by-Step Process of Custom Software Development

Creating a custom software solution involves a structured process to ensure all aspects are covered:

1. Requirement Gathering

This initial phase involves documenting the needs and expectations of stakeholders through surveys, interviews, and workshops.

2. Planning and Design

After gathering requirements, developers create a blueprint through wireframes and prototypes, ensuring clarity before diving into coding.

3. Development

The actual coding begins in this phase, where developers build the software according to the specifications defined during the planning stage.

4. Testing

Rigorous testing is crucial to identify potential issues before the software goes live. Quality assurance teams conduct various tests to ensure functionality, security, and performance.

5. Deployment

The finalized product is launched and made available for users, along with necessary training and documentation.

6. Maintenance and Support

Custom software requires ongoing updates, enhancements, and support to adapt to changing needs and eliminate bugs post-launch.

Conclusion

The professional landscape is shifting swiftly, and business leaders must leverage every tool at their disposal to stay competitive. Custom software development provides a powerful avenue for organizations ready to invest in tailored solutions that align with their unique operational needs. By undertaking custom software initiatives, businesses not only streamline processes and enhance productivity but also lay a solid foundation for future growth and innovation.

About Our Company

Bamboo Digital Technologies

Bamboo Digital Technologies (BDT), the international arm of Robust & Rapid System in China, is a Hong Kong-registered software development company delivering secure, scalable and compliant fintech software solutions—from custom eWallet and digital banking platforms to payment systems—empowering financial institutions and enterprises worldwide to innovate with confidence.

Quick Support

info@bamboodt.com

Custom eWallet Software Development

Bamboodt offers tailored eWallet software solutions for payment companies, enabling fast and secure digital wallet creation for individual users. With our proven payment technology and customizable features, we help you accelerate time-to-market and deliver seamless payment experiences to your customers.

Armed with extensive contactless payment methods like QR code, NFC, USSD, & Virtual Cards to make your customer’s transactions a whole lot easier & quicker.

Designed with best UI and UX practices, FFT software Mobile Wallet can be tailored to fit your branding seamlessly, and provids a hassle-free experience for your customers.

Based on FFT payment tech platform, enables easy customization of features, workflows, and integrations to fit your unique needs. FFT’s payment tech platform is designed to be future-proof, allowing for instant scaling locally and globally.

Custom All-Inclusive Payment Software Solutions

Bamboodt’s all-inclusive payment software solution supports the complete lifecycle of a transaction, from initiation to settlement. Our platform monitors transactions in real-time, performs risk checks, and consolidates payment data securely, providing payment companies with scalable and customizable solutions for seamless processing.

Empower different businesses – from online e-commerce marketplaces to brick-and-mortar stores with to accept payments across various channels.

Get maximum flexibility to customize the payment transaction flow and offer frictionless transaction processing both in-store and a secure payment gateway for online transactions.

Support an unlimited number of currencies and let merchants accept card payments, process digital wallet transactions as well as bank debit card payments, etc.

Custom Prepaid Card Payment System Development

Bamboodt provides secure and scalable prepaid card payment system development, enabling payment companies to easily issue, activate, and manage prepaid card programs. Our solutions offer full transaction security, seamless integration, and customizable features to meet the needs of modern financial systems.

From card issuance, activation, and management, to an admin view of the solution, manage all card operations at your fingertips.

Empower your customers with advanced self-service features. Let them activate cards, make payments, load funds, check balances, view transactions & more, leading to enhanced satisfaction

Custom Digital Banking Software Solutions

Bamboodt offers comprehensive digital banking software solutions for financial institutions, enabling seamless, secure, and scalable banking services. Our platform allows banks to provide customers with convenient, real-time banking experiences anytime, anywhere, while maintaining full control over security and compliance.

Tailor the customer experience to their unique preferences and habits by delivering content and services through the most appropriate channels

Allowing consistent user experience access across channels.

Boost your product and service offering by seamlessly integrating with other financial or non-financial service providers, unlock a world of opportunities to deliver innovation for your customers to enjoy.

About Our Company

Why we do?

At BDT, we believe that technology can empower financial institutions and enterprises to innovate with confidence. Our mission is to provide secure, scalable, and compliant fintech software solutions that help our clients deliver better digital services to their customers worldwide.

What we do?

We specialize in custom software development for fintech, offering digital banking platforms, eWallet solutions, payment systems, and smart enterprise applications. By combining proven expertise with innovative technology, we help our clients accelerate digital transformation, ensure compliance, and build software that drives long-term growth.

Company Environment

Trusted by

Certificate

Get in Touch

Begin an agile & reliable journey today

    Note:Our main focus is on ewallet/payment solutions and software development services. We're unable to offer job placement or loan services.
    Please only submit information related to our core services. This helps us serve you better.
    Thank you for your understanding.

    By processing, I accept terms of bamboodt Service and confirm that I have read bamboodt Privacy Policy.

    Get in Touch

    Make An Free Consultant

      Note:Our main focus is on ewallet/payment solutions and software development services. We're unable to offer job placement or loan services.
      Please only submit information related to our core services. This helps us serve you better.
      Thank you for your understanding.

      By processing, I accept terms of bamboodt Service and confirm that I have read bamboodt Privacy Policy.